Bike components
Frame
Frame
Rose BACKROAD Carbon, 12x142TA, PF86, internal shift/brake cables, mounting points for luggage carrier, frame weight from approx. 1020g, deepest purple 50cm
Suspension Fork
Rose BACKROAD Carbon, 12x100TA, internal brake hose, mounting points for Gravel cage, fork weight from approx. 425g, matt black/deepest purple
Drivetrain
Rear Derailleur
Shimano GRX RX810 rear derailleur 11-speed (for single & double chainring setups)
Front Derailleur
Shimano GRX FD-RX810 11-speed front derailleur
Cassette
Shimano 105 CS-R7000, 11-34
Crank
Shimano GRX FC-RX810 2 x 11-speed, 48-31T 170mm
Bottom Bracket
BB86/BB92, press-fit
Chain
Shimano CN-HG601, 118 links
Pedals
delivered without pedals
Wheels
Rims
ROSE R Thirty Disc Light / 28” / 28 holes / Inner rim width: approx. 19mm / Rim height: approx. 31mm / Rim width: approx. 24mm / Weight: approx. 1520g / Compatible tyre widths: 700x28-60mm black
Tires
Continental Terra Speed ProTection, Tubeless Ready, schwarz/transparent (dunkelbraun) 40-622
Brakes
Brakes
Shimano BL-RX810 / BR-RX810, ST-RX810, 2x, 160mm /160mm
Cockpit
Stem
Rose Square (6°), aluminium 6061, integrated cable guides, anodized black 70mm
Handlebar
Ritchey WCS Butano, blatte 40cm
Seat
Saddle
Rose Edition by Selle Italia black
Seatpost
ROSE D-Shape, for Reveal/Backroad, carbon, 8 mm offset UD carbon/matt
Fit data
Numbers for sizing and ride feel.
| Size | 50cm | 53cm | 55cm | 57cm | 59cm | 62cm |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Stack Reach Ratio | 1.45 mm | 1.46 mm | 1.48 mm | 1.48 mm | 1.49 mm | 1.5 mm |
| Front Center | 585 mm | 597 mm | 606 mm | 617 mm | 628 mm | 649 mm |
| Rake | 47 mm | 47 mm | 47 mm | 47 mm | 47 mm | 47 mm |
| Trail | 69 mm | 69 mm | 67 mm | 67 mm | 64 mm | 63 mm |
| Stack | 535 mm | 554 mm | 569 mm | 585 mm | 600 mm | 622 mm |
| Reach | 370 mm | 379 mm | 385 mm | 394 mm | 403 mm | 416 mm |
| Top Tube Length | 514 mm | 533 mm | 549 mm | 567 mm | 581 mm | 601 mm |
| Seat Tube Angle | 75 ° | 74.5 ° | 74 ° | 73.5 ° | 73.5 ° | 73.5 ° |
| Seat Tube Length | 450 mm | 480 mm | 500 mm | 520 mm | 540 mm | 575 mm |
| Head Tube Angle | 71 ° | 71.25 ° | 71.5 ° | 71.75 ° | 72 ° | 72 ° |
| Head Tube Length | 100 mm | 120 mm | 135 mm | 150 mm | 165 mm | 188 mm |
| Chainstay Length | 426 mm | 426 mm | 426 mm | 433 mm | 433 mm | 433 mm |
| Wheelbase | 999 mm | 1011 mm | 1020 mm | 1038 mm | 1050 mm | 1071 mm |
| Bottom Bracket Drop | 76 mm | 76 mm | 76 mm | 76 mm | 76 mm | 76 mm |
| Wheels | 700 | 700 | 700 | 700 | 700 | 700 |

Overview of components
Fork material
The fork on this bike is made out of carbon, so, it won’t add up to much weight to your bike. However, the price you have to pay for a carbon fork is considerably higher.
Wheels size
When leaving the production line, the BACKROAD GRX RX810 model has 700c aluminum wheels. There is no doubt, that 700c wheels are very popular on all road bike models. However, these wheels don’t perform so well when passing over obstacles.
Brakes
Nothing is more important on a bike than its ability to brake properly. Rose BACKROAD GRX RX810 is equipped with Hydraulic Disc brakes. With Hydraulic Disc brakes, you’ll be able to stop on a dime, even in wet or icy conditions. To sum up, your safety is in good hands.
